The Colors Around You Matter More Than You Think

Color choices are rarely arbitrary. Airlines deliberately favor blue for its associations with calm and trustworthiness. While red can stimulate action and excitement, excessive red can create anxiety. This is why it is carefully balanced. Green reminds us of the natural world. It often fosters a feeling of calm within a room.   

The team carefully adjusts and calibrates the lighting at each and every phase of the journey. This ensures perfect ambiance. Bright, cold light aids takeoff and landing, while amber light prepares the body for sleep. This is particularly so on long flights. Some planes mimic the soft shift of a sunrise or sunset. This assists travelers in resetting their internal biological clocks more gently.

Your Seat Tells a Story

The people at LifePort say that aircraft interiors reflect years of research about human comfort and psychology. Seat cushions are engineered to a narrowly defined firmness curve. If the density is too low, the occupant sinks and experiences pressure on the pelvis; if too high, the back protests with micro-movements. Manufacturers prototype hundreds of viscoelastic and polymer blends until the fatigue test yields the just-right compression-relaxation ratio.

Headrest geometry calibrates the balance between perception of enclosure and openness. Winged profiles create a protective shoulder-frame that many passengers unconsciously associate with safety. Flatter, lower edges permit a perceptually expansive space but yield a thinner veil of privacy. Selection depends on the anticipated demographic and travel habits of the airline’s clientele. Sounds You Never Notice

Beneath the veneer of sterile calm, airlines govern the acoustic environment with near-invisible diligence. Engine vibration is abated by multi-layered sound-blocking partitions. Cabin orientation to the power plants meanwhile is rehearsed to diminish tonal harmonics on the critical-band frequency that the human ear attunes to stress. Decades of research have led to variable-speed blowers that curb the register of airflow whine, and even the dampened but still perceptible thud of a shut overhead bin is tuned to covey density and closure.

The background noise within an aircraft cabin subtly shapes travelers’ emotions. Absolute quiet often registers as unsettling, while excess din creates unnecessary anxiety. Carriers, therefore, engineer a soft, steady sonic layer, calibrated to be both nearly inaudible and mysteriously relaxing.

Subtle Behavioral Choreography

Carriers deploy discreet design elements to steer passenger behavior. Aisle widths deliberately widen near cabin splits, allowing an unobtrusive glimpse of first-class space as guests board. Magazine holders and catering carts are placed to direct pedestrian flows without conscious thought.

Zone-temperature management goes beyond thermal comfort. A light chill at boarding sharpens focus for safety briefings; a gradual warmth later invites tranquil rest. Meal-service timing, finally, is calibrated to align with circadian signals dictated by the departing time zone, mitigating jet lag and maximizing satisfaction.
